Transaction 2893fe64f8386a41f8a9a21709149ea6d8453fd0b291f6cae5a02a3b2d522a7e
1 Input
1 Output
-
2893fe64f8386a41f8a9a21709149ea6d8453fd0b291f6cae5a02a3b2d522a7e:0
- value
- 713729
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3f5074e17410f3bff2e3cebeed2199dedd4d304
- address
- bc1q506swnshgy8nhlew8n47a5senhkaf5cyz3uv0j